Business of Courts WebRule Absolute Law and Legal Definition A rule absolute is an order that can be enforced at once, in contradistinction to a rule nisi, which commands the opposite party to appear on a day therein named and show cause why he should not perform the act or submit to the terms therein set forth. htf 520wp7 https://serendipityoflitchfield.com
